What the data shows in Bilsborrow

Collisions in Bilsborrow are most frequently recorded on a Tuesday (19.6% of the total), with 29.4% happening in darkness rather than daylight. The most common posted speed limit at the scene is 60 mph.

94.1% of recorded collisions in Bilsborrow happen on a single carriageway. Around 11.8% were recorded in adverse weather such as rain, snow or fog.

The collisions in Bilsborrow have produced 158 casualties. Pedestrians account for 1.9% of those casualties, a marker of the risk to people on foot here.

Where does the road accident data for Bilsborrow come from?

It comes from STATS19, the official record of personal-injury road collisions reported to the police and published by the Department for Transport. The figures for Bilsborrow cover 1999 to 2024.
